Pinpoint Test H: The Transmission Control Module (TCM) Does Not Respond To The Scan Tool

- H1 CHECK THE POWER TO THE TCM
- Key in OFF position.
- Disconnect: TCM C1458a
- Key in ON position.
- Measure the voltage between the TCM, harness side and ground as follows:
Connector-Pin Circuit C1458a-4 CBB27 (GN/BN) C1458a-5 CBB27 (GN/BN) C1458a-12 SBB08 (VT/RD) - Are the voltages greater than 10 volts?
- YES : Go to H2.
- NO : VERIFY the battery junction box (BJB) fuse 27 (10A) or fuse 8 (5A) is OK. If OK, REPAIR the circuit in question. CLEAR the DTCs. REPEAT the network test with the scan tool.
- H2 CHECK THE TCM GROUNDS
- Key in OFF position.
- Measure the resistance between the TCM harness side and ground as follows:
Connector-Pin Circuit C1458a-2 GD121 (BK/YE) C1458a-8 GD121 (BK/YE) - Are the resistances less than 5 ohms?
- YES : Go to H3.
- NO : REPAIR the circuit in question. CLEAR the DTCs. REPEAT the network test with the scan tool.
- H3 CHECK THE HS-CAN CIRCUITS BETWEEN THE TCM AND THE DATA LINK CONNECTOR (DLC) FOR AN OPEN
- Measure the resistance between the TCM C1458a-1, circuit VDB04 (WH/BU), harness side and the DLC C251-6, circuit VDB04 (WH/BU), harness side; and between the TCM C1458a-7, circuit VDB05 (WH), harness side and the DLC C251-14, circuit VDB05 (WH), harness side.
- Are the resistances less than 5 ohms?
- YES : Go to H4.
- NO : REPAIR the circuit in question. CLEAR the DTCs. REPEAT the network test with the scan tool.
- H4 CHECK FOR CORRECT TCM OPERATION
- Disconnect the TCM connector.
- Check for:
- corrosion
- damaged pins
- pushed-out pins
- Connect the TCM connector and make sure it seats correctly.
- Operate the system and verify the concern is still present.
- Is the concern still present?
- YES : INSTALL a new TCM. REFER to AUTOMATIC TRANSAXLE/TRANSMISSION - ELECTRONICALLY CONTROLLED CONTINUOUSLY VARIABLE TRANSMISSION (ECVT) article. CLEAR the DTCs. REPEAT the network test with the scan tool.
- NO : The system is operating correctly at this time. The concern may have been caused by a loose or corroded connector. CLEAR the DTCs. REPEAT the network test with the scan tool.
